CT Dental Imaging for Implant Planning

A dental implant is a highly sophisticated procedure. The more information a surgeon has about the anatomy of the patient's mouth before a dental implant, the better the outcome. Important measurements for the surgeon to know include the width and density of the bony ridge in order to assess implant feasibility and the exact placement of the alveolar nerve in order to prevent painful nerve damage.

Traditional panoramic x-rays provide only a limited two-dimensional view. While they can show the height and contour of the bony ridge, they give no indication of the bone width and density and may distort the placement of the alveolar nerve.

State-of-the-art three-dimensional computerized tomography (CT) dental scanning takes the guesswork out of implants. This quick and safe diagnostic imaging exam produces life-like spatial views of the mouth that let the surgeon determine pre-surgically if a patient is an implant candidate. With 3D imaging, a surgeon can proceed with confidence, knowing the amount of bone a patient has, the distance to the alveolar nerve and the exact angles to situate the implant.

A CT scan is a safe procedure. Because our scanner is so fast, patients are through with their test in a fraction of the time of other scanners, greatly reducing their x-ray exposure. With a CT dental scan, there is no contrast dye involved and the entire exam takes about 15 minutes. After the exam, our 3D imaging staff produces three-dimensional images which provide the surgeon with valuable data crucial to the success of the implant.
